As a graphic artist, I am seriously thinking about creating a website, to showcase my Adobe artwork.

When it comes to choosing the best host for a site, do other artists who already have their own, typically have it as a Shared Web configuration or a Virtual Private Server? If it's a VPS, what is the most common memory & storage amount 2GB, 4GB or 8GB?

Any advice is greatly appreciated.

    If you're a Creative Cloud full plan member,  you have free access to Adobe Portfolio.  It's hosted on Adobe's servers and as far as I know, there is no limit to how many images, videos, etc... that you can showcase on your PF site.  

    Adobe Portfolio | Build your own personalized website

    If you want to build your site in DW, shared hosting is the most affordable and probably more than adequate for your needs.  You can always upgrade later if need be.

    If you use WordPress, I recommend getting WordPress hosting which costs a bit more but servers are optimized for better WP performance.   Well worth the extra cost IMO.
